Metro Canada and Uber Eats team up for hot meal delivery
Canadian food and drug retailer Metro Inc. has joined forces with Uber Eats for home delivery of ready-to-eat meals in Quebec: 23 stores now deliver prepared meals to customers in Montreal, Laval and the South Shore area, who place orders via the Uber Eats app. The rollout of the service follows a 3-store pilot. Meals available for delivery include a selection of sandwich and salad combos for lunch, and a menu of individual and family-sized dinners. Orders are delivered in about 30 minutes.
